At Pop Century, I don't think the in-room safes will hold a laptop, I will have no car for safe storage.

Should I have worries about leaving a laptop bag in my room?

If you're concerned about your laptop, you can buy one of these kensington laptop locks for about 30 dollars, most laptops have a slot for it with a little icon of a lock with a K inside. You can wrap the cord around something stable in the room and you should be safe! I hope this helps.
